2026 GS-15 Pay in Pittsburgh
GS-15 employees with a duty station in Pittsburgh-New Castle-Weirton, PA-OH-WV earn 21.03% on top of the base GS-15 pay scale. That means a GS-15 Step 1 salary jumps from $126,384 on the base table to $152,963 in Pittsburgh.
2026 GS-15 Pay in Pittsburgh
Locality-adjusted GS-15 rates for Pittsburgh-New Castle-Weirton, PA-OH-WV.
| Step | Annual salary | Biweekly pay | Hourly rate | Locality add-on |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Step 1 | $152,963 | $5,883.19 | $73.29 | +$26,579 |
| Step 2 | $158,062 | $6,079.31 | $75.74 | +$27,465 |
| Step 3 | $163,161 | $6,275.42 | $78.18 | +$28,351 |
| Step 4 | $168,260 | $6,471.54 | $80.62 | +$29,237 |
| Step 5 | $173,359 | $6,667.65 | $83.07 | +$30,123 |
| Step 6 | $178,458 | $6,863.77 | $85.51 | +$31,009 |
| Step 7 | $183,557 | $7,059.88 | $87.95 | +$31,895 |
| Step 8 | $188,656 | $7,256.00 | $90.40 | +$32,781 |
| Step 9 | $193,755 | $7,452.12 | $92.84 | +$33,667 |
| Step 10 | $197,200 | $7,584.62 | $94.49 | +$32,899 |

GS-15 in Pittsburgh: what to expect
Senior executives just below the Senior Executive Service. Division directors, senior scientists and agency experts typically top out at GS-15.
For 2026, the Pittsburgh pay area adds a 21.03% locality adjustment on top of the nationwide base GS schedule. Every GS-15 employee assigned to this area benefits from that same percentage, regardless of step or series.
Qualifications and career path
Minimum qualifications. One year of specialized experience at the GS-14 level, plus demonstrated leadership.
Promotion path. Further advancement requires selection into the Senior Executive Service (SES).
The rough military equivalent for GS-15 is O-6 Colonel, useful for comparing GS roles against enlisted and officer ranks when looking at pay or authority level.
Biweekly take-home for GS-15 in Pittsburgh
Before taxes and deductions, a GS-15 Step 1 employee in Pittsburgh earns roughly $5,883 per biweekly pay period. At Step 10 that rises to $7,585. Actual take-home will be lower after federal tax, state tax, TSP contributions, retirement and health insurance deductions.

How much does a GS-15 make in Pittsburgh?
In 2026, a GS-15 Step 1 employee in Pittsburgh earns $152,963 per year. At Step 10 the salary reaches $197,200. This is 21.03% higher than the base GS-15 salary. -
What is the locality adjustment for GS-15 in Pittsburgh?
The locality adjustment is the same for every grade and step within a pay area. For Pittsburgh in 2026, it is 21.03%. On a GS-15 Step 1 salary that translates to an extra $26,579 per year. -
What is the biweekly pay for GS-15 in Pittsburgh?
Biweekly pay is annual salary divided by 26. A GS-15 Step 1 employee in Pittsburgh earns roughly $5,883 per pay period before tax and retirement deductions.
